    Producer: Deep Blue Sea. Alan Riche was born on 1 November 1941 in Buffalo, New York, USA. He is a producer and executive, known for Deep Blue Sea (1999), The Legend of Tarzan (2016) and Southpaw (2015). He has been married to Wendy Riche since 4 December 1966. They have two children.
